Ergonomics and Comfort in the Sky

Designing the interior of a flying car presents unique ergonomic challenges. Unlike traditional cars‚ flying cars operate in three dimensions‚ requiring pilots (or potentially automated systems) to manage altitude‚ direction‚ and speed in a complex aerial environment. Therefore‚ the layout and accessibility of controls are paramount.

  • Intuitive Controls: Controls must be easily understandable and accessible‚ even under stressful flight conditions.
  • Comfortable Seating: Seats need to provide ample support and comfort for extended periods in the air‚ potentially incorporating features like adjustable lumbar support and vibration dampening.

Material Selection for Flying Car Interiors

The choice of materials is critical‚ considering both weight and safety. Lightweight‚ durable materials like carbon fiber and advanced composites are likely to be prevalent. Fire-resistant and impact-absorbing materials are also essential for passenger safety.

Technology Integration and the Future Cockpit

The interior of a flying car will be a hub of advanced technology. Expect to see sophisticated navigation systems‚ automated flight controls‚ and advanced communication capabilities. Entertainment systems and connectivity features will also be integrated to enhance the passenger experience.

  • Advanced Navigation Systems: GPS‚ radar‚ and lidar systems will be essential for safe and efficient navigation.
  • Automated Flight Controls: Self-flying capabilities will likely be a key feature‚ allowing for a more relaxed and enjoyable travel experience.

Safety Features and Considerations

Safety is the paramount concern in flying car design. Interiors must be equipped with advanced safety features‚ including airbags‚ emergency landing systems‚ and robust structural integrity. Escape mechanisms and emergency procedures will also be crucial considerations.

Factoid: Some flying car designs incorporate parachute systems that can deploy in the event of a catastrophic failure‚ providing a last-resort safety measure.

The Impact on Urban Planning

The widespread adoption of flying cars could have a profound impact on urban planning. The design of vertiports (landing and takeoff facilities for flying cars) will need to consider the passenger experience‚ including the design of waiting areas‚ security checkpoints‚ and connections to other modes of transportation.

  • Vertiport Design: Vertiports will need to be strategically located and designed to minimize noise and visual impact on surrounding communities.
  • Air Traffic Management: Sophisticated air traffic management systems will be essential to ensure the safe and efficient flow of flying cars in urban airspace.
